按下“卖出”却被静音:TP钱包无法卖币的技术与商业全景剖析

当你在TP钱包里按下“卖出”,却被一行报错或交易失败挡在门外,这既是技术的谜题,也是商业与合规的试金石。先从Solidity看起:许多无法卖出的根源在合约层面——非标准ERC-20实现、缺失transferFrom或approve逻辑、合约被paused、黑名单/白名单限制,甚至是重入、溢出漏洞与未正确发出Transfer/Approval事件,都会让钱包或去中心化交易所无法监听并执行交易。

代币合规层面https://www.fanjiwenhua.top ,同样关键:链上增加的KYC、地域性禁售、受限代币模型(受限期、线性解锁)会在钱包端出现“无法卖出”的体验。事件处理方面,规范且可索引的事件(带indexed参数的Transfer/Approval)是保障前端和链下服务同步的基础,缺失或错误的事件会让聚合器、行情引擎与钱包状态不同步。

商业逻辑上,设计自动做市、流动性锁定、回购销毁、手续费分成等智能商业模式时,要兼顾流动性释放节奏与二级市场的可兑换性。技术全球化应用要求合约与前端支持多链、多语言、多签与桥接,采用OpenZeppelin模版、EIP-2612(permit)、跨链桥与Layer 2解决方案能显著提升兼容性与用户体验。

放眼市场趋势,监管趋严、DEX生态碎片化、合规化代币标准化成为长期主题。对于项目方与开发者,最佳路径是:审计与标准化合约、完善事件与日志、明确代币经济与合规规则、在钱包端提供透明提示与退路。只有把代码写成信任,把商业设计写成承诺,用户才能在按下“卖出”时,听到链上真正的回应。

作者:林栩发布时间:2025-12-18 15:16:37

评论

Sora

读得透彻,尤其是事件处理那段,发现问题从链上日志入手非常实用。

钱多多

合规和流动性设计常被忽视,文章提醒很及时,项目方应该收藏。

Alex99

建议再补充一些实际的debug步骤,比如如何在Etherscan和节点日志里排查Transfer事件缺失。

区块链小明

写得生动,把技术和商业结合得很好,看完有行动清单的感觉。

相关阅读